Exploring the Apple Cider Vinegar Diet Plan

Have you ever considered the apple cider vinegar diet plan as a route to your wellness goals? This approach has recently gained popularity for its potential health benefits, including weight loss, improved digestion, and even better skin health. Apple cider vinegar, or ACV, is not just a kitchen staple but may also be a hidden gem in your journey towards a healthier lifestyle.

ACV is made by fermenting the sugar from apples which turns them into acetic acid – the active ingredient in vinegar. This acetic acid is what’s believed to be responsible for ACV’s health benefits. Navigating the Basics of an Apple Cider Vinegar Diet

At first glance, the apple cider vinegar diet plan appears straightforward. Typically, it involves consuming a small amount of apple cider vinegar, about 1-2 tablespoons, diluted in a large glass of water, about 20-30 minutes before each meal. The idea is that ACV can help promote feelings of fullness, helping you consume fewer calories and potentially leading to weight loss.

However, it’s not just about sipping vinegar. A healthy ACV diet plan also emphasizes balanced food choices. Prioritizing f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ins can optimize the diet’s effectiveness by incorporating overall nutritional balance.

Some useful tips for incorporating ACV into your diet:

  • Start with small doses: Begin with one teaspoon of ACV in a full glass of water to see how your body reacts before increasing it to a tablespoon.
  • Always dilute it: ACV should never be consumed straight due to its acidic nature which can harm your tooth enamel and throat.
  • Opt for raw, unfiltered apple cider vinegar: This type contains ‘the mother’— strands of proteins, enzymes, and friendly bacteria beneficial to your health.
  • Monitor your body’s reaction: Not everyone may experience the benefits of ACV, or it may cause discomfort for some. Monitoring your body’s reaction is key.
